Plumber Services in Alberton, Gauteng
In Alberton, Gauteng, domestic and commercial plumbing professionals offer a broad range of essential health and comfort services. From emergency callouts to routine maintenance, plumbers in this South African centre address water supply, drainage and heating systems with practical, site-specific solutions. The work typically blends technical skill with an emphasis on safety, reliability and compliance with local norms and building practices.
Common services include the installation and repair of hot and cold water systems, gas fittings where applicable, and the removal or prevention of leaks. Plumbers in Alberton are often asked to diagnose issues such as low water pressure, running toilets, and dripping taps, then implement fixes that may involve replacing seals, tightening connections, or upgrading components to improve efficiency and durability. Drainage work is another core area, covering inspections for blockages, clearing sewer lines, and installing or repairing traps, cleanouts and drainage pipes to maintain effective wastewater flow.
Water heating is a key focus for many clients. Plumbers commonly install, service and repair hot water cylinders and systems, including electric and solar installations when appropriate. They assess heating performance, inspect thermostats and safety devices, and ensure correct venting and pressure relief where required. In addition, maintenance tasks such as descaling, flushing, and replacing corroded fittings help extend the life of water heating equipment and protect against unexpected failures.
For property owners and building managers, sustainable practices are increasingly important. Plumbers in Alberton often advise on water-saving measures, efficient fixtures, and leak detection strategies to reduce waste and lower utility costs. They may also assist with routine inspections of essential systems, scheduling preventive maintenance to minimise disruption and identify issues before they escalate into costly repairs.
Work is typically carried out through a straightforward sequence. A client describes the issue or project, followed by a preliminary assessment by the plumber. This may involve a site visit to measure, inspect and discuss options, timelines and expectations. Once a plan is agreed, the work proceeds with appropriate materials, tools and safety considerations. After completion, a licensed tradesperson will usually test the system to confirm correct operation and provide guidance on maintenance or remedial steps.

Practical considerations for customers include ensuring access to the work area and providing clear information about the observed symptoms and any related events, such as recent renovations or weather conditions. It is prudent to obtain a written estimate or quotation outlining materials, labour, and any potential extra costs before work begins. When possible, requesting references or checking local trade credentials can help buyers feel confident in the contractor’s reliability and workmanship. In urban and suburban Alberton, response times can vary depending on traffic conditions and the scale of the job, but reputable plumbers typically communicate anticipated timelines and follow up on any post-work concerns to safeguard service quality.
